Western Quality is a federally inspected facility that has implemented the Food Safety Enhancement Program (FSEP) and received HACCP recognition in 2004. The HACCP procedures and programs are regularly verified by the HACCP Coordinator and CFIA inspectors.


HACCP (Hazard Analysis and Critical Control Point) is a comprehensive preventative food-safety system used to protect food from actual and potential hazards. It is a management system that addresses food safety through the analysis and control of biological, chemical, and physical hazards associated with all raw materials and finished product processes.
